What have I learned?
I have learned that you will not magically make money without doing any work.
I have learned that great content will not make you a ton of money in the beginning.
I have learned that interaction is as important as content.
I have learned that the more time you take helping others, the more time others will take to help you.
I have learned that a few really good comments, are much more valuable than 100 meaningless comments.
I have learned a ton about Steem dollars, Steem, Steem power, and voting. I love, because I am a numbers person.
I have learned there is not a lot of content on my areas of expertise; cars and real estate.
